#bba4b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bba4b4 is composed of 73.3% red, 64.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.3%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 318.3 degrees, a saturation of 14.5% and a lightness of 68.8%. #bba4b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#774969.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#bba4b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bba4b4 has RGB values of R:187, G:164,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.04,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12297396.

Shades and Tints of #bba4b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0809 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
